Creating a believable ebony avatar for romantic storylines is notoriously difficult. Darker skin tones in VR often suffer from poor lighting dynamics, losing facial expressions in shadow. Developers are now using subsurface scattering algorithms specifically calibrated for melanin-rich skin to ensure that smiles, blushes, and tears are visible.
Similarly, hair physics for protective styles (braids, locs, twists) requires complex coding to move naturally during a massage scene. When a user runs their virtual fingers through a lover’s locs, the haptic feedback must simulate the slight tug and texture. This level of detail separates a cheap gimmick from a genuine emotional experience.
